LV rates highly in most surveys. What the reviews don't tell us is that once LV has you as a customer and your policy is on 'autorenewal' they will put your premium up steeply at the end of the first year, banking on your reluctance to go through the bother of changing again. Last year, after reading a review, I took out motor, home, and travel insurance with LV . At the end of the first year, (last month), each premium went up by over 16%. When I complained to LV, the sales rep said, 'well, let me see if I can improve on that,' but it was too late. Insurers have to show some loyalty to their customers. I found another insurer.

I can absolutely confirm that LV= would never pass on or sell your data to any claims management companies. All of our claims are dealt with by our own in-house claims team. It does however sound as though you may have been a victim of ‘Vishing’, and we’ve put together a page of information that may help you here https://www.lv.com/about-us/company-information/fighting-financial-crime/vishing. This page includes details of how to contact the Telephone Preference Service and the Information Commissioner’s Office who may be able to offer further advice. Many thanks, Jake
